The book offers profound insights into how we operate within our spiritual lives. Key themes such as prayer, obedience, and the necessity of spiritual disciplines are interwoven throughout. Baker’s encouraging message reassures readers that activating one’s faith is about developing a relationship with the Word and the Spirit—grounded and supported by Scripture. He states, “With a sincere commitment, anyone can unlock all the provisions available through Christ’s redemptive work.”
This transformational journey is evidenced in reviews, where one reader notes, “The author takes one much deeper into the understanding of the relationship with the Holy Spirit. This is not just a Sunday Morning relationship; it’s an every moment of every day relationship.” This highlights the relevance and applicability of Baker’s teachings in our lives.
For practical application, consider integrating the book into your daily routine. Whether it’s during a solo devotional, a men’s group discussion, or personal mentorship, each chapter contains useful tools—study guides and reflective questions—designed to enhance your engagement with the material.

Key takeaways from Baker’s work include:
- Faith is Relational: Recognizing that our walk with Christ is more about relationship than ritual.
- Active Engagement: Committing to spiritual disciplines fosters a vibrant faith that reflects Christ’s love and leadership.
- Community Focus: Discipleship flourishes in environments of brotherhood and mutual support.
